“I regularly read Latina Lista and I have a question for you. I find the direction this country is taking regarding immigration very disturbing. Beyond letting my Congress-critters know how I feel, how can I get involved? What can I do to change the tone of the discourse? What groups especially local to NYC, my hometown can I volunteer with or assist?
E-mail from a Latina Lista readerIts not unusual for readers to contact Latina Lista and ask this question.
I can certainly understand the frustration from reading about all that is happening in the country regarding undocumented immigrants, and even the problems themselves of Latino youth, and wonder that there has to be something more than just reading blogs regurgitating the dire injustices or statistics.”
